Babies are too often given antibiotics like amoxicillin for viral illnesses which can cause rashes and then the parents are told the baby is allergic to the drug.
A skin rash can be indicative of both a normal side effect and an allergic reaction.
It can happen with the use of the amoxicillin or a combination of amoxicillin with clavulanic acid. Many times when a baby is diagnosed with an allergy to a drug its not really an allergy.
